Zurich is a city located in Ellis County, Kansas. Zurich has a 2026 population of 81. Zurich is currently declining at a rate of -1.22% annually and its population has decreased by -5.81%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 86 in 2020.
The median household income in Zurich is $78,750 with a poverty rate of 6%. The median age in Zurich is 67.3 years: 70 years for males, and 61.5 years for females. For every 100 females there are 66.7 males.
